Dalston Junction station is well-equipped with ticket machines and accessible ticket machines, making ticket purchasing quick and convenient. Although the ticket office is only open during limited hours, from 07:30 to 10:00 on weekdays and 12:30 to 14:45 on Saturdays, you can collect pre-purchased tickets from machines at any time. If you require assistance or information, staff at Dalston Junction are ready to help, and you can also rely on information displayed on screens for departure and arrival updates.
Accessibility is a top priority at Dalston Junction, with step-free access throughout the station and lift access to all platforms. Moreover, facilities such as induction loops, ramps for train access, and accessible toilets are available, ensuring that everyone can travel comfortably and confidently.
Getting around from Dalston Junction is a breeze, thanks to local bus services and rail replacement services. Use bus stop M in Kingsland High Street for southbound services to New Cross and New Cross Gate, or bus stop L for northbound services to Dalston Kingsland. While there are no dedicated cycle hire facilities, you will find cycle storage racks at the station with around 15 spaces, sheltered to protect from the elements and under CCTV surveillance for added security.

New Pudsey station offers a range of services catering to both seasoned travelers and newcomers. For ticketing, the station is equipped with a ticket office open Monday through Saturday. There are accessible ticket machines available that accept both cash and card payments, making ticket purchase and collection convenient for everyone. The station provides extras like a reliable induction loop service and smartcard options for tech-savvy travelers.
Accessibility at New Pudsey is well considered with step-free access throughout the station. Categories like 'A' certification and being marked as a scooter-friendly station underline its suitability for passengers requiring additional support. The platforms are connected by a ramped footbridge, and further assistance can be requested via the Passenger Assist service, ensuring a smooth journey for all.
